Nonprofit that has run a completely free overnight summer camp near Mattawan since 1916 for Kalamazoo County-area youth who could not otherwise afford camp. It serves about 800 campers ages 8-15 (after 3rd through before 10th grade) each summer, providing everything from transportation to clothing, with outdoor play, swimming and new activities aimed at building self-esteem and independence.
